我正试图使用命令行与团队资源管理器到处解除搁置搁置集。我一直收到这个错误:
An error occurred: TF400016: Unshelve with Merge is not supported on the version of Team Foundation Server on which your team project is hosted.
shelvesset与我试图打开架子的那个在同一分支上。在试图解除搁置之前,我已经运行了tf undo -recursive .
,它告诉我没有未决的更改,所以我不确定为什么它试图合并。有人在这方面取得过成功吗?谢谢你的帮助。
自创建架子集以来,tfs中的文件是否更改过?如果您试图将文件的前一个版本的集合卸载到后续版本上,我也看到了同样的问题。要解决这个问题,您可以提取与搁置集匹配的代码,然后解除搁置,然后获得最新的代码,合并将正确进行。